In one of my html forms I had to use html element "<select multiple name=...", so when the user selects multiple items, we got a datastream like this: var1=value1&var1=value2&var1=value3... etc. Original function returned only the first value of var1. I know the remark states that it retrieves only a single value, but since I did not found an other function retrieving multiple values like that, I took some guts, and made some modification to it. Just in case someone faces the same problem, here is the modified code. In case of multiple values, they are separated by CRLFs, so the result can be loaded to a TString descendent's Text property for example .
